Abstract

Bolete specimens collected in Baima Snow Mountain Nature Reserve, Yunnan Province, were identified as Pseudobaorangia lakhanpalii, based on morphological and phylogenetic analyses. The ITS sequences of our collections exhibited a high similarity with Boletus lakhanpalii (99.53% for KEF13271 and 99.44% for KEF13272). However, because of limited molecular data and complex taxonomic relationships of Boletaceae, the phylogenetic placement of B. lakhanpalii could not be clearly determined. This study conducted a phylogenetic analysis by combining nrLSU, RPB2 and TEF1-α genes, and the results showed that this species has a close phylogenetic relationship with Baorangia, sharing some morphological characteristics, but also having several highlighting differences. Therefore, a new genus Pseudobaorangia is proposed with P. lakhanpalii as the type species and its detailed description is provided.
